💡 Tips

  • Travel here requires robust logistics, a reliable 4x4 vehicle, and up-to-date local security advice.
  • Bring all essential supplies, including water purification, basic medicines, and enough cash for your entire stay.
  • Knowing a few basic greetings in Sango will go a long way with the local community.
  • Respect local village chiefs and seek permission before taking photographs in the communities.

🍽 Food

🍽
Cassava (Manioc) Dishes

The staple carbohydrate of the region, usually served as a dense paste alongside a sauce.

🍽
Wild Forest Fruits

Depending on the season, locals forage various fruits and nuts from the surrounding forests.

🍽
Local River Fish

If available, freshly caught fish from nearby rivers, often smoked or stewed.

Gadzi is a significant small town in southwestern Central African Republic, located within the Mambéré-Kadéï prefecture along the transport axis between Berbérati and Carnot. The town serves as an important administrative and economic center for the surrounding region, which is characterized by dense equatorial forests and fertile savannas. The local economy is largely driven by the artisanal mining of diamonds and gold, with many residents working in the nearby river valleys. Beyond mineral resources, agriculture plays a central role, particularly the cultivation of cassava, bananas, and coffee for both subsistence and regional trade. Historically, Gadzi was an essential hub for the timber industry, favored by the abundance of precious hardwoods in the area. The population is predominantly from the Gbaya ethnic group, whose traditions and languages shape the town's social fabric. Despite infrastructural challenges, Gadzi remains a vital marketplace for agricultural goods and mining equipment. The town hosts local government offices, educational institutions, and a health post that provides essential medical care for the rural population of the sub-prefecture.

Facts

  • Gadzi is geographically positioned between the mining hubs of Berbérati and Carnot.
  • The town serves as the administrative center for its namesake sub-prefecture.
  • Diamonds and gold are the primary export goods of the surrounding area.
  • The region is rich in precious hardwoods such as Sapelli and Ayous.
  • Cassava is the main staple food crop grown in the local region.
  • The town is linked by unpaved roads to the regional transportation network.
